A family member recently got sick and I REALLY don't want to catch it but I still want to help them, what steps can I take to make sure they're okay and that I also don't get sick?

Phone your ill family member and talk to him or her; ask how they’re feeling and if they need anything. Let them know that you will be happy to bring over the item(s). Before you go into your ill family member’s home, put on latex gloves and a disposable mask over your nose and mouth to help protect you from the virus. Then when you leave, peel off the gloves, dispose of them and wash your hands with soap and water or clean them with gel. Reducing the chance that you have touched or breathed in the virus will help keep you from catching the cold.

Recently a family member got into a bad motorcycle accident. He is really active (almost 70) but is now stuck in bed recovering for a long time. What is the most kind thing I could do to cheer him up? He gets exhausted if anyone visits him.

Dear Amy Zapa,I have a couple of ideas for you, from two years ago when a good friend, out-of-state, was bedridden.Recently a family member got into a bad motorcycle accident. He is really active (almost 70) but is now stuck in bed recovering for a long time. What is the most kind thing I could do to cheer him up? He gets exhausted if anyone visits him.I mailed her a greeting card every day! Also she loved fantasy and mythology, so I would find online artwork by the fantasy illustrators she loved most, or maybe a short story in the genre she loved, and I would dress them up with red hearts, rainbows, or other stickers I got at the dollar store.Sounds like your family member is male, so perhaps you could print off things from online in his areas of interest, maybe even jokes? A fun little gift in the mail each day gave my friend something to look forward to, and she told her family all this mail made her feel very special.* * *If your family member is close by, consider coming by occasionally with a similar tiny gift, or perhaps something special to eat, along with a great big smile. Don’t stay, just say you wanted to see him for a second. Kiss him or touch him if that is appropriate in your family, and then leave.
